Chlorine in PDB 5ub4: XAC2383 From Xanthomonas Citri Bound to Phosphate

Protein crystallography data

The structure of XAC2383 From Xanthomonas Citri Bound to Phosphate, PDB code: 5ub4 was solved by R.D.Teixeira, C.R.Guzzo, C.S.Farah, with X-Ray Crystallography technique. A brief refinement statistics is given in the table below:

Resolution Low / High (Å) 43.71 / 2.09
Space group P 21 21 21
Cell size a, b, c (Å), α, β, γ (°) 66.880, 67.094, 113.492, 90.00, 90.00, 90.00
R / Rfree (%) 17 / 22.6
